Product details

Overview

STM8AL3L68TAY from STMicroelectronics is an AEC-Q100 qualified automotive-grade 8-bit ultra-low-power MCU with 32 Kbyte Flash, 2 Kbyte RAM, 1 Kbyte data EEPROM, integrated LCD controller (4×28 segments), 12-bit ADC (25 channels, up to 1 Mbps), 12-bit DAC, two ultra-low-power comparators, RTC with BCD calendar and auto-wakeup, and multiple timers including a 16-bit advanced control timer for motor control. It operates from 1.65 V to 3.6 V across –40 °C to 125 °C and targets body electronics, dashboard instrumentation, and smart sensors.

Technical Context

The STM8AL3L68TAY implements a Harvard-architecture STM8 core with 3-stage pipeline, delivering 16 CISC MIPS at 16 MHz. Its clock system integrates dual crystal oscillators (1–16 MHz HSE and 32 kHz LSE), factory-trimmed 16 MHz RC, and 38 kHz low-consumption RC, all managed by a clock security system.

Power management includes five low-power modes-Wait, low-power run (5.1 μA), low-power wait (3 μA), active-halt with full RTC (1.3 μA), and halt with PDR (400 nA)-and features a programmable voltage detector, ultra-safe BOR with five thresholds, and POR/PDR optimized for automotive transients.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Core Architecture STM8 8-bit Harvard core with 3-stage pipeline; enables deterministic real-time execution and efficient code density for safety-critical automotive firmware.
Max Clock Frequency 16 MHz; delivers 16 CISC MIPS peak performance while maintaining ultra-low power consumption in active and low-power modes.
Flash Memory 32 Kbyte Flash with 20-year data retention at 55 °C; supports in-application programming and robust over-the-air update capability.
ADC Resolution & Speed 12-bit ADC, up to 1 Mbps sampling rate across 25 channels; includes internal temperature sensor and reference voltage for self-calibration.
Low-Power Halt Current 400 nA with PDR enabled; enables multi-year battery operation in always-on automotive modules such as door controllers or tire pressure monitors.
LCD Driver Supports up to 4×28 segment LCD with integrated step-up converter; eliminates external bias supply and reduces BOM count in instrument cluster designs.
RTC Accuracy 0.95 ppm resolution with auto-wakeup from Halt; provides precise timekeeping and periodic interrupt generation without CPU intervention.

Pinout & Package

LQFP48 package (7 × 7 mm, 0.5 mm pitch), RoHS-compliant, ECOPACK®2 qualified. Pin count and I/O mapping align with STM8AL3Lxx series automotive variant.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
VDD, VSS Power supply and ground Dual VDD/VSS pairs ensure stable core and I/O domain operation under automotive load dump and cold-crank conditions.
NRST Active-low reset input Accepts Schmitt-triggered signal with programmable BOR threshold; supports safe initialization after brownout or ESD event.
PA0–PA7, PB0–PB7, PC0–PC7, PD0–PD7, PE0–PE7 General-purpose I/Os 41 mappable I/Os with interrupt capability; PA0 supports high-sink LED driver (up to 20 mA) for direct indicator control.
OSC_IN / OSC_OUT HSE crystal oscillator interface Supports 1–16 MHz external crystal; used for precise timing in LIN/USART communication and RTC calibration.
LSE_IN / LSE_OUT LSE crystal oscillator interface 32 kHz crystal connection for RTC; enables ultra-low-power timekeeping with <1.3 μA active-halt current.
VLCD LCD voltage supply output Integrated step-up converter generates adjustable VLCD (2.3–5.5 V); eliminates external charge pump in segmented display applications.

Key Features

Feature Design Value
AEC-Q100 Grade 1 qualification Validated for –40 °C to 125 °C operation with extended reliability testing; meets automotive functional safety prerequisites.
Ultra-low leakage per I/O 50 nA typical leakage; minimizes standby current in systems with high I/O count and long sleep intervals.
Dual ultra-low-power comparators One comparator with rail-to-rail input and one with fixed 1.22 V threshold; enables wake-on-event sensing without ADC overhead.
SWIM debug interface Single-wire non-intrusive debugging; allows full on-chip programming and real-time variable inspection without halting peripheral operation.
96-bit unique ID Factory-programmed serial number; supports secure boot, device authentication, and traceability in production and field firmware updates.

Applications

Automotive Instrument Cluster Smart Door Control Module

Use Scenario: Driving digital gauges, warning indicators, and backlight dimming in analog/digital hybrid dashboards.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Primary MCU managing LCD segment drive, PWM-controlled LED backlight, and LIN bus communication with body control module.

Use Value: Integrated LCD controller and 4×28 segment support eliminate external display driver IC; 400 nA halt mode extends battery backup runtime during ignition-off periods.

Use Scenario: Monitoring window lift position, detecting obstacle contact, and controlling power window motor via H-bridge.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Real-time motor control unit using TIM1 advanced timer for complementary PWM generation and comparator-based stall detection.

Use Value: 16-bit advanced control timer with dead-time insertion and comparator-triggered emergency stop ensures functional safety compliance in ASIL-B-relevant subsystems.

Automotive Tire Pressure Monitor (TPMS) Sensor Node Engine Bay Ambient Sensor Hub

Use Scenario: Battery-powered wireless sensor collecting pressure, temperature, and acceleration data for RF transmission.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Ultra-low-power host MCU performing periodic ADC sampling, RTC-timed wakeups, and SPI communication with RF transceiver.

Use Value: 1.3 μA active-halt mode with full RTC enables 10+ year battery life; internal 38 kHz RC oscillator reduces external component count and PCB area.

Use Scenario: Multi-sensor aggregation node measuring coolant temperature, intake air temp, and humidity near engine compartment.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Signal conditioning and preprocessing unit using 12-bit ADC, internal temp sensor, and DAC for analog output calibration.

Use Value: On-chip 12-bit DAC (PB4–PB6) provides programmable reference voltage for sensor signal offset correction; 125 °C rating ensures reliable operation in harsh thermal environments.

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ar ultra-low-power automotive MCU applications.

Alternative Part Technical Difference Application Difference Selection Advice
STM8AL3L48TAY Same package and pinout; 16 Kbyte Flash, 1 Kbyte RAM, no DAC, 16-segment LCD support Suitable for simpler instrumentation or sensor nodes where DAC and extended memory are unnecessary Select when cost sensitivity outweighs need for DAC or larger program space; retains identical low-power profile and AEC-Q100 qualification.
RL78/F13-GB Renesas RL78 core; 32 Kbyte Flash, 2 Kbyte RAM, but no integrated LCD driver or 32 kHz crystal RTC option Requires external LCD bias circuitry and separate RTC IC for calendar functions Choose if existing RL78 toolchain and ecosystem integration are prioritized over integrated display and ultra-low-power RTC autonomy.

Compared with STM8AL3L48TAY, the STM8AL3L68TAY adds DAC, doubles Flash/RAM, and expands LCD capability-justifying upgrade for feature-rich clusters. Versus RL78/F13-GB, it offers superior integration for LCD-centric automotive HMI with lower total BOM cost and faster time-to-market.

FAQ

Is STM8AL3L68TAY pin-compatible with other STM8AL3Lxx devices in LQFP48?

Yes-STM8AL3L68TAY shares identical LQFP48 pinout with STM8AL3L48TAY and STM8AL3L66TAY. All share the same peripheral mapping, I/O assignment, and power/ground pin locations, enabling hardware reuse across variants with differing Flash size or feature sets.

Does STM8AL3L68TAY support LIN 2.0 physical layer directly?

No-it supports LIN 2.0 protocol stack via USART with software-based bit timing and checksum handling, but requires an external LIN transceiver (e.g., TLE7259-3GE) for ISO 17987-4 compliant physical layer signaling and bus protection.

What is the maximum operating frequency of the 12-bit DAC output?

The DAC supports continuous output at up to 1 MHz update rate when driven by TIM2 trigger; DC accuracy is ±1 LSB INL/DNL over temperature, with output buffer capable of driving 500 Ω loads without external op-amp.

Can the internal 38 kHz RC oscillator be used as RTC clock source?

No-the 38 kHz RC is designated for low-power run/wait modes only. The RTC must use either the 32 kHz LSE crystal oscillator or the 32 kHz LSI RC oscillator; LSE provides 0.95 ppm resolution and is required for precision calendar operation.
